DescriptionThonzonium bromide is a monocationic detergent.(In Vitro):Thonzonium bromide inhibits RANKL-induced OC formation, the appearance of OC-specific marker genes and bone-resorbing activity in vitro. Thonzonium bromide blocks the RANKL-induced activation of NF-κB, ERK and c-Fos as well as the induction of NFATc1 which is essential for OC formation. Thonzonium bromide disrupts F-actin ring formation resulting in disturbances in cytoskeletal structure in mature OCs during bone resorption. Thonzonium bromide exhibits protective effects in an in vivo murine model of LPS-induced calvarial osteolysis.
